First of, don’t let the word “aioli” scare you away.  It’s really just a fancy, schmancy way of saying “mayo”.  In this case the mayo, or aioli, is jacked up with garlic, lime, salt and pepper.  That’s it.  Nothing scary.  Just lots of great flavor and a fancy name.
